Fred J. Koenekamp
Edit
Got his start as a first cameraman on
The Man from U.N.C.L.E. (1964)
.
Received a Lifetime Achievement Award from the American Society of Cinematographers in 2005.
His first job in films was as a camera loader at RKO in 1947.
Worked for 14 years at MGM, starting as assistant cameraman.
Served for 3-1/2 years with the U.S. Navy in the South Pacific during World War II.
